Diagnostic Imagining Administrative Coordinator – Mercy Allen Hospital (Oberlin, OH)

Shift/Schedule

  • Full Time - Scheduled for 40 Weekly Hours

  • Shift Times - Days/Afternoons (8am-4:30pm Monday through Friday)

Summary of Primary Function/General Purpose of Position:

The Diagnostic Imagining Administrative Coordinator performs specialized office and clerical support tasks. The Coordinator operates with minimal supervision and may exercise independent judgment in completing assignments. The Coordinator upholds the standards of the system-wide customer service program.

Essential Job Functions:

  • Assists with payroll

  • Coordinates department ODH / Quality Assurance Program, calendars, and schedules meetings.

  • System coordinator / super user for Epic which includes training new users, including tech, radiologists, and secretaries. Update and maintain menus and tables. Troubleshooting and system corrections. Responsible for yearly update. Administrative level for printing and routing. Verifies & corrects all billing & transcription issues.

  • Serves as preliminary contact for the Diagnostic Imaging patients by:

  • Greeting patients in person or via telephone in a pleasant and professional manner.

  • Prioritizing patients according to practice guidelines.

  • Dispensing information about practice operations and / or relaying messages.

  • Interacting with the different ancillary services to complete patient schedules and resolve issues.

  • Performs clerical duties as required by the position to ensure the maintenance of an efficient department. Help maintain department binders. Assist in updating policies and procedures. Orders supplies

  • Maintain positive customer service attitude when dealing with the public and hospital personnel. Work effectively as a team member and uses collaborative approach to problem solving.

  • Keeps abreast of trends, developments, and practices by participating in continuing education courses and reading current literature. Participates in Hospital required education programs

  • Upload images into PACS, burn discs, and fix PACS issues.

  • Maintains technologists’ radiation badges and print out reports.

  • Assist with revenue entry and usage; verify issues and make corrections.
